Meanings of venomous

  • adjective
    1. Full of venom.
    2. Toxic; poisonous.
    3. Noxious; evil.
    4. Malignant; spiteful; hateful.
    5. Producing venom (a toxin usually injected into an enemy or prey by biting or stinging) in glands or accumulating venom from food.
    6. Powerful.

Example Sentences

  • The cobra is one of the most venomous snakes in the world.
  • Her venomous tone made it clear that she was deeply hurt.
  • The spider's venomous bite can cause severe pain and swelling.
  • He shot a venomous glare at his rival across the table.
  • The jungle is home to numerous venomous creatures that require caution.
